Non-number value in Charts
I am trying to make a non-number value show up in a column chart. The chart
is automatically showing any non-number value as zero. This is fine, however I would like the Display Data Labels to show the value that is displayed in the cell. How do I do this? |

Non-number value in Charts
I think you're actually wanting to display either series name, or category
name. If you just want custom labels on individual data points/columns, you'll need to manually edit the labels yourself by selecting the value, then clicking again (aka, a slow double click). -- Best Regards, Luke M *Remember to click "yes" if this post helped you!* "erawson" wrote: I am trying to make a non-number value show up in a column chart. Non-number value in Charts
Use a different range for labels and add them to chart an Excel chart label
add-in Rob Bovey's Chart Labeler, http://appspro.com John Walkenbach's Chart Tools, http://j-walk.com Tushar's Hover Chart Label utility: http://tushar-mehta.com/excel/softwa...bel/index.html best wishes -- Bernard V Liengme Microsoft Excel MVP http://people.stfx.ca/bliengme remove caps from email "erawson" wrote in message ...
